Sierpinski square curve: Difference between revisions
Content added Content deleted
m (Minor edit) |
m (Minor edit) |
||
Line 139:
try (Writer writer = new BufferedWriter(new FileWriter("sierpinski_square.svg"))) {
SierpinskiSquareCurve s = new SierpinskiSquareCurve(writer);
int size = 635, length = 5;
s.currentAngle = 0;
s.currentX =
s.currentY =
s.lineLength =
s.begin(
s.execute(rewrite(5));
s.end();
Line 173 ⟶ 174:
break;
case '+':
turn(
break;
case '-':
turn(-ANGLE);
break;
}
|